A coin is at rest at bottom of a tank filled with liquid. A ray of light coming towards surface will move on the surface after incident on it, then what is the speed of light in liquid ?

Answer»

`2.4xx10^8 ms^(-1)`
`3.0xx10^8 ms^(-1)`
`1.2xx10^8ms^(-1)`
`1.8xx10^8ms^(-1)`

Solution :
Length of hypotenuse of RIGHT ANGLE `triangle`1ABC is 5.
`therefore (1)/(mu)=(sini)/(SIN 90^@)` …...
(`because` Refractive index of LIQUID =`mu`, refractive index of air =1)
`therefore mu =(1)/(sini)=5/3`
Now speed `v=(c)/(mu)=(3xx10^8)/(5/3)=1.8xx10^8` m`//`s
